The PAL is going to SIOP!

It looks like the People Analytics Lab is going to have a few submissions in for SIOP 2019. This year, we will have four presentations. Here is a list of what’s to come. If you are going to SIOP, then please stop by!

Dr. Christopher Castille presenting…

  1. Examining how we might use psychometric network analysis in coaching to develop ideal employees. Simonet, D., Castille, C., Harris, A., & Bunn, B. (2019, April). Psychometric Network Analysis and Ideal Points Assessment: Developing Ideal Employees. Presented at the 34th Annual Conference for the Society for Industrial and Organizational Psychology, Inc., National Harbor, MD.

    • Presentation details: Thursday, April 4th, at 4:30PM in Prince George’s Exhibit Hall D
  2. Improving the prediction of counterproductive behavior using trait activation theory. Simonet, D. V., Castille, C., DeSanto, D., Cruz, A., Janeiro, A., & Angelbeck, A. (2014). Dark triad unleashed: Examining trait activators linking dark traits to CWB. Presented at the Annual Conference for the Society for Industrial and Organizational Psychology, Inc., National Harbor, MD.

    • Presentation details: Thursday, April 4th, at 4:30PM in Prince George’s Exhibit Hall D
  3. Discussing how to make industrial and organizational psychology more open and transparent in both science and practice. Morrison, M., Castille, C. M., Oswald, F. L., Buckner, J. E., & Rogelberg, S. (2019, April). Open Science, Open Practice: Future Reality or Pipedream? Presented at the d Organizational Psychology, Inc.

    • Presentation details: Saturday, April 6th, at 11:30AM in Chesapeake A-C

Dr. Ann-Marie Castille presenting…

  1. What effects do performance feedback messages have on motivation and performance? Several, as it turns out. Castille, A.-M. R., & Desselles, M. (2019). Modeling the relationship between performance feedback, affect, cognition, and goals. Presented at the Annual Conference for the Society for Industrial and Organizational Psychology, Inc., National Harbor, MD.

    • Presentation details: Saturday, April 6th, at 3:00PM in Prince George’s Exhibit Hall D
